Revenue, excluding grants (current LCU), per capita in Paraguay
Paraguay: Revenue, excluding grants (current LCU), per capita was 9.11 million current LCU per person in 2024. ▲ Rising
Revenue, excluding grants (current LCU), per capita in Paraguay, 2005–2024
Source: Statizoid (derived). Measured in current LCU per person.
Analysis
In 2024, revenue, excluding grants (current lcu), per capita in Paraguay stood at 9.11 million current LCU per person. That is the highest value across all 20 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 12.9% on the previous year and up 83.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, revenue, excluding grants (current lcu), per capita in Paraguay peaked at 9.11 million current LCU per person in 2024 and was at its lowest, 1.77 million current LCU per person, in 2005.
Paraguay ranks 4th of 157 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 20 years of available data.

How this figure is calculated
Revenue, excluding grants (current LCU) divided by Population, total, mat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Revenue, excluding grants (current LCU) ÷ Population, total
Computed from
- Revenue, excluding grants Government Finance Statistics Yearbook and data files, International Monetary Fund (IMF)
- Population, total World Population Prospects, United Nations (UN)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
